Ali Abdaal
Dr Ali Abdaal is the world’s most followed productivity expert and author of Feel-Good Productivity, the brand new book that reveals why the secret to productivity isn’t discipline, it’s joy. In his podcast, Deep Dive, Ali sits down with inspiring creators, thinkers, entrepreneurs and high performers to help listeners build lives that they love.
Ali’s cheerful style, positive approach, and well-researched content have made him a trusted voice when it comes to productivity. The internet means that we have access to more knowledge and information than ever before - but it can also be overwhelming. So, Ali and his expert guests focus on simple, scientifically proven, and actionable steps you can take to make real changes in your life.
Ali’s a firm believer that happiness isn’t the result of success - in fact, happiness is the key to success in the first place. Ali made this discovery while working as a doctor in a chaotic hospital ward. In the past, hard work had been the answer to every obstacle in his life. But no amount of hard work was going to combat panic and burnout.
So, Ali dedicated himself to figuring out a new approach to productivity - one that focuses on enjoying the journey and working towards truly meaningful goals. Deep Dive, with its authentic and engaging conversations, will give you all the insights you need to do just that.

World Poker Champion On The Science Of Decision Making - Chris Sparks
Chris Sparks, a retired professional poker player and performance coach, shares fascinating insights into decision-making derived from poker strategies. He discusses the psychological edge in competition and the importance of systems thinking in achieving success. Sparks emphasizes treating life as a series of experiments and the value of understanding both our own and others' problems. His framework encourages evaluating risks using expected value, while also highlighting how personal growth stems from self-assessment and overcoming biases.

World's Leading Expert On How To Solve Procrastination - Dr Tim Pychyl
In this engaging discussion, Dr. Tim Pychyl, a retired psychology professor and procrastination expert, delves into the emotional roots of procrastination. He differentiates between procrastination and delay, revealing why putting things off can sometimes feel good. Tim shares practical strategies for nudging ourselves into better habits and the importance of meaningful goal-setting. He also touches on how emotional insights and spiritual flow can help combat procrastination, offering a fresh perspective on achieving effortlessness and motivation.

Moral Philosopher Will MacAskill on What We Owe The Future
Will MacAskill, an Associate Professor in Philosophy at Oxford and co-founder of Effective Altruism, discusses how to create a positive impact on future generations. He reveals the philosophy behind longtermism and why it's crucial to consider our moral obligations today. The conversation highlights the transformative power of effective altruism, the importance of strategic philanthropy, and the urgent existential risks we face, like climate change and nuclear threats. MacAskill also shares insights on career choices and the emotional rewards of altruistic giving.
